However, for bimetallic parts to operate properly, they have to be made of high quality materials that can be permanently joined over the entire contact surface. This is because components made of such materials have unique physical and chemical properties. Recently, bimetallic materials, i.e., materials produced by permanently fastening two or more metals or metal alloys, have been increasingly used in machine construction. The results reported in this paper are preliminary and constitute a prelude to a more detailed analysis of bimetallic rod rolling. In addition, the distribution of stress in the tool–workpiece contact zone may make welding of the materials difficult. The results of numerical modeling indicate that the material near the surface tends to flow, which may have a negative impact on the welding process. When the rods are heated without protective atmospheres, the surface layer of the core gets decarburized and the surfaces of the materials being joined together are oxidized, which hinders the welding process and adversely affects the physical and chemical properties of such products. However, proper fastening of the two materials depends on the geometrical parameters of the billets, and the quality of bimetallic rods depends on the heating method used. The results demonstrate that the proposed method can be successfully used in the production of bimetallic rods. During the tests, bimetallic rods were rolled from billets whose cores and outer sleeves (bushings) were made of different types of steel. The experiments were conducted using a numerically controlled three-roller skew rolling mill.
